Output 436f2a7cae30d86206de32298d64bfa709c8f6424e712aba079c818980c1f59c:0

value
9415269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ba06632aab81854314c7895a4deacc00e235d78f OP_EQUAL
address
3JedG2VE9GMQ9uf51DLGXmtvNRby5e94FK
transaction
436f2a7cae30d86206de32298d64bfa709c8f6424e712aba079c818980c1f59c
confirmations
138162
spent
true